I'm looking for a sub for the OE color of Goldie.
The paint code is 4E1, which is the light topaz metallic.
DupliColor, et al, no longer carry paint for our mature cars, and I really balk at $22/can plus the clear coat plus shipping for some of the custom color places (not that I doubt their accuracy/quality, though).
I'm contemplating painting the grille the body color, after doing some computer painting of a photo - and viewing the Japanese Tercel that was pictured a while back (Mattel furnished?).
Anyone have a suggestion? My local AZ and Advance do not seem to have anything very close that is off the rack.
